Before delving into the comparison, it's important to first understand what Static Residential IPs and SOCKS5 proxies are, and how they function.
Static Residential IPs are assigned to a specific physical location and a particular internet service provider (ISP). These IP addresses are linked to real residential addresses, making them highly reliable for users who need to maintain a consistent online presence over time. Static Residential IPs are often used in applications that require a stable connection, such as e-commerce, social media management, and data scraping, as they mimic the behavior of an average internet user.
SOCKS5 proxies are a type of proxy server that acts as an intermediary between the user’s device and the target server. Unlike HTTP proxies, which only handle web traffic, SOCKS5 proxies can handle all types of internet traffic, including email, FTP, and torrents. SOCKS5 is often favored for its flexibility and the ability to support various protocols. It also provides better performance and security compared to other proxy types.
Now, let’s dive into a comparison between these two popular proxy options. The following aspects will be discussed: anonymity, performance, reliability, and security.
Static Residential IPs offer a high level of anonymity because they are linked to real residential addresses. This makes them difficult to detect by websites, as they appear to be regular users accessing the internet from a home network. Static Residential IPs are less likely to be flagged by websites or blocked, making them a good option for activities like web scraping, where avoiding detection is crucial.
SOCKS5 proxies are also considered to provide a good level of anonymity, but they lack the residential aspect. While SOCKS5 proxies route traffic through a remote server, they do not appear as regular users to the same degree as Static Residential IPs. Websites may detect SOCKS5 proxies faster and block them if they are flagged. However, SOCKS5 proxies can still offer strong anonymity when used correctly, especially if they are from trusted providers.
When it comes to performance, Static Residential IPs generally offer stable and consistent speeds. These IPs are typically linked to broadband connections, which means they can handle high-bandwidth activities such as streaming, gaming, and data scraping. However, the speed of Static Residential IPs can vary depending on the region, the ISP, and the specific IP being used.
SOCKS5 proxies typically provide faster performance than Static Residential IPs. They offer low latency and can support various protocols with minimal slowdown. This is especially useful for users who need high-speed connections for tasks like online gaming, video streaming, or large data transfers. Since SOCKS5 proxies are not tied to a specific residential ISP, they often have better scalability, allowing users to switch between multiple servers to optimize their connection speeds.
Static Residential IPs excel in terms of reliability. These IPs are designed to provide a consistent experience over time, which is crucial for long-term projects. Users can rely on Static Residential IPs for maintaining their online identity, as they do not change frequently. This stability makes them ideal for tasks such as e-commerce, where maintaining a consistent online presence is essential.
SOCKS5 proxies are typically less reliable than Static Residential IPs in terms of consistency. Since SOCKS5 proxies are often hosted on data centers, they may be subject to periodic downtime or performance fluctuations. Additionally, users may need to manually switch between different socks5 proxy servers to ensure continued access to restricted websites, especially if their proxy gets blocked or blacklisted.

Static Residential IPs are generally more expensive than SOCKS5 proxies due to their high level of reliability, security, and anonymity. The cost can vary depending on the provider, location, and number of IPs needed. For businesses or individuals who require stable and long-term connections, the higher cost may be justified by the benefits.
SOCKS5 proxies tend to be more affordable than Static Residential IPs. Their pricing model is often more flexible, and they can be purchased in smaller quantities. This makes SOCKS5 proxies an attractive option for users who need a cost-effective solution for tasks like basic web browsing, accessing geo-restricted content, or securing internet traffic.
Static Residential IPs are best suited for activities that require long-term, stable connections and high anonymity. These include:
- Web scraping and data collection
- Social media management
- E-commerce and online marketing
- Avoiding IP blacklisting or geo-restrictions
SOCKS5 proxies are ideal for:
- High-speed online activities such as gaming or streaming
- Secure and anonymous browsing
- Accessing restricted content
- Torrenting and P2P activities
